Vous êtes sur la page 1sur 24

Tlphonie Mobile

GPRS General Packet Radio Service (2,5G)


LP R&T RSFS - Dpartement R&T
1

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Introduction

Technologie GPRS : General Packet Radio Service


Base sur la norme GSM Transmission par paquets, en mode non connect

Allocation des ressources au coup par coup Taxation sur le volume de donnes changes (en kbits)

Objectif : accs mobile aux rseaux IP

2 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ture matrielle

Deux rseaux en parallle


GSM : services classiques relatifs la voix GPRS : transport des donnes Utilisation commune des quipements de la BSS (mmes bandes de frquences) Sparation des deux rseaux au niveau du NSS

GPRS vers rseaux fixes de donnes ou autres GPRS GSM vers RTCP ou autres GSM

Nouveaux quipements

SGSN (Serving GPRS Support Node) ~ MSC G-GSN (Gateway GPRS Support Node) ~ G-MSC

Rseau fdrateur ou reseau coeur GPRS


3

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ture matrielle


RTCP
Rseau GSM dun autre oprateur
G-MSC

BSC BSC
MSC G-MSC

Voix
BSC
MSC

VLR

HLR

4 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ture matrielle


RTCP
Rseau GSM dun autre oprateur
G-MSC

BSC BSC
MSC G-MSC

Voix
BSC

Donnes

Gb

Gs
SGSN

MSC

VLR

Gr Gn Gc

HLR

Circuit de donnes GPRS Circuit de signalisation uniquement

BSC SGSN BSC

Gn
G-GSN
G-GSN

Rseau de donnes IP, X25,


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

Rseau GPRS dun autre oprateur


5

GPRS : Nouveaux quipements

SGSN (Nud de service GPRS)


Assure le routage et le transfert des paquets de donnes vers et depuis les mobiles GPRS Gre la mobilit Joue le rle du VLR (stockage de donnes pour la localisation) Assure des fonctions de facturation et dauthentification

G-GSN (Nud passerelle GPRS)


Permet le routage vers et depuis les rseaux de donnes externes vers le SGSN du mobile GPRS concern Stocke ladresse des SGSN courants des mobiles Assure des fonctions de facturation et dauthentification.
6

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Connexion entre nuds GPRS

Rseau Backbone GPRS

Tous les GSNs sont relis entre eux par un rseau IP


Rseau PDP (rseaux de donnes X.25, IP)

Gi Gp

Backbone Inter-PLMN

Gi

Gp

G-GSN

BG

BG

G-GSN

Backbone Intra-PLMN *

Backbone Intra-PLMN *

SGSN

SGSN

PLMN A

PLMN B

SGSN

SGSN

* Rseau IP priv oprateur Frdric Payan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Principe gnral de transmission de donnes


BSC

Rseau coeur GPRS


Dsencapsulation
@IP SGSN

MS (@PDP)
(@IP) SGSN

@PDP MS || Donnes

Tunnel Backbone Intra-PLMN (rseau IP)


G-GSN (@IP)

Encapsulation dans un datagramme IP

@PDP MS || Donnes

SGSN et G-GSN ont une IP fixe dans le PLMN Chaque mobile a une adresse PDP compatible avec le rseau externe SGSNG-GSN : principe dencapsulation et mise en tunnel : protocole GTP (GPRS Tunnel Protocol)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ur
Rseau PDP IP, X25,

GPRS : Architecture des protocoles

Structuration en couches
Sparation en deux plans:

Plan de transmission : gestion de la transmission de donnes et sa signalisation associe Plan de signalisation : gestion de lchange de signalisation pure (mise jour localisation, allocations ressources)

9 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ture des protocoles

Plan de transmission (ou usager)

Appli. PDP SNDCP LLC RLC MAC


GSM RF

PDP SNDCP LLC RLC MAC


GSM RF
Interface Um

GTP TCP/UDP IP L2
L1
Interface Gn

GTP TCP/UDP IP L2
L1

BSSGP Net. Service


L1 bis
Interface Gb

BSSGP Net. Service


L1 bis

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

MS

(BTS+BSC)

BSS

SGSN

G-GSN

10

GPRS : Architecture des protocoles

PDP (Packet Data Protocol) : Protocole standard du rseau fixe de donnes auquel est connect le G-GSN (IP, X.25) GTP (GPRS Tunnel Protocol) : Mise en place du tunnel pour le transfert de donnes G-GSN SGSN TCP/UDP (Transport / User - Datagram Protocol) : Assure le transport G-GSN SGSN avec / sans acquittement (X.25, transfert fiable / IP pas de transfert fiable) IP (Internet Protocol) : Assure lacheminenement des donnes G-GSN SGSN (encapsulation avec @IP)
11

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ture des protocoles

SNDCP (Subnetwork Dependent Convergence Protocol) : interface entre les protocoles standard de niveau 3 des rseaux fixes et les couches de niveau 2 des rseaux radiomobiles : assure le transfert des donnes MSSGSN. LLC (Logical Link Control) : Etablit des procdures de transfert dinformations pour assurer une transmission fiable MSSGSN. Effectue aussi le cryptage. RLC (Radio Link Control) : role similaire au LLC mais pour MS BSS MAC (Medium Access Control) : Controle laccs au canal radio BSSGP (BSS GPRS Protocol) : transporte les informations de routage et de QoS BSSSGSN (~BSSMAP)
12

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Architecture des protocoles

Plan de signalisation (similaire au plan usager)


SM (Session Management) : signalisation pour la gestion des sessions GMM (GPRS Mobility Management) : sign. pour la gestion de la mobilit

SM

SM S

SM

SM S

GMM LLC RLC MAC


GSM RF

GMM LLC RLC MAC


GSM RF
Interface Um

GTP TCP/UDP IP L2
L1
Interface Gn

GTP UDP IP L2
L1

BSSGP Net. Service


L1 bis
Interface Gb

BSSGP Net. Service


L1 bis

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

MS

(BTS+BSC)

BSS

SGSN

G-GSN

13

GPRS : Mobilit

Gestion inspire du gsm :


Mcanisme de mise jour de la localisation Mcanisme de paging Zone de routage (Routing Area, RA) : plusieurs cellules par zone, sous-ensemble dune zone de localisation

Toutes les cellules dpendent du mme SGSN

Zone de localisation

Zone de routage 1
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

Zone de routage 2

14

GPRS : Mobilit

3 tats possibles pour le mobile


appels tats GMM (GPRS Mobility Management) Connu par le SGSN dont le mobile dpend
Mobile non joignable (localisation inconnue) Dtachement du rseau (GPRS Detach) Etat IDLE Attachement au rseau (GPRS Attach) Expiration de la temporisation Transfert de donnes (montant ou descendant) Dtachement du rseau (GPRS Detach) Etat READY Mobile directement joignable (localise la cellule prs)
15

Mobile Etat joignable par paging STANDBY (localise la zone de routage prs)

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Gestion de la localisation

Mise en uvre lors de GPRS Attach, changement de zone et priodiquement Mise jour en tat Standby

A chaque changement de zone de routage (protocole GMM)

Si la nouvelle RA dpend du mme SGSN, celui-ci remplace simplement son identit (~intra MSC/VLR) Si la nouvelle RA dpend dun autre SGSN, transfert du profil de labonn depuis le HLR vers le nouveau SGSN, et lancien SGSN efface ces donnes (~inter MSC/VLR)

Mise jour en tat Ready

A chaque changement de cellule (protocole GMM)


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

Idem en tat Standby Arrt du transfert de donnes ~5 secondes, durant lesquels le SGSN stocke les paquets arrivants avant de les renvoyer la nouvelle cellule.

16

GPRS : Contexte PDP

Fonction

Pour une session GPRS, un mobile active un contexte PDP contenant les caractristiques de la session Permet au mobile GPRS dexister au niveau du rseau externe PDP : il peut alors mettre/recevoir des donnes
Type de rseau utilis (IP, X.25) @ PDP du mobile

Contenu

@ IP du SGSN courant (utilis pour le tunneling depuis le G-GSN) MS, SGSN courant, G-GSN concern.
17

Fixe : assign par loprateur de manire permanente Dynamique assign par le G-GSN durant la phase dactivation

Stockage

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Liaison Radio

Canal physique : idem GSM

Rptition dun timeslot sur trames TDMA :

Canal physique

0123 4567 0123 4567 0123 4567

Trame TDMA

Dans une cellule, ressource partage entre GSM et GPRS : un canal physique est soit GSM soit GPRS. Diffrence avec le GSM :

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

Rserv uniquement lors de transfert (donc partag entre pls mobiles) Possibilit de rserver jusqu 8 TS dune trame TDMA pour un seul mobile => dbit plus levs Les TS sont allous de faon indpendante en UL et en DL => transmisssion asymtrique

18

GPRS : Liaison Radio

Un canal physique configur en GPRS est appel PDCH (Packet Data CHannel

Canal logique :

similaire au GSM

Canaux de trafic et de contrle associs Canaux de diffusion et de contrle commun

19 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Liaison Radio

4 niveaux de codage de canal (selon qualit de transmission)


CS-1 : 9,05 kbits/s CS-2 : 13,4 kbits/s CS-3 : 15,6 kbits/s CS-4 : 21,4 kbits/s

Permet le trafic point--point et point--multipoint


Dbit GPRS :

Dbit thorique de 8x21,4 = 171,2 kbits/s

20 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Liaison Radio

Echange de PDU RLC/MAC


Transmission dun PDU en un bloc de 4 bursts normaux (=GSM) 4 tailles possibles selon le codage canal
Couche RLC/MAC Couche Physique En-tte Donnes

Un bloc de donnes Codage canal

(+ entrelacement)

21 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

GPRS : Limites

Les oprateurs utilisent uniquement


En pratique, utilisation des codages CS-1 et CS-2 configurations 3+1 et 4+1


3 ou 4 TS en voie descendante 1 TS en voie montante

Les en-ttes ne sont pas pris en compte dans les dbits annoncs !

=> En pratique dbit max (sens descendant) : 4*12=48 kbits/s

Saturation des bandes de frquence du GSM


22 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

Tlphonie Mobile
EDGE Enhanced Data for GSM Evolution 2,75G

23

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ur

EDGE Principales caractristiques


EDGE : Enhanced Data for GSM Evolution

Principe

Modulation 8PSK au lieu de GMSK 2 tats (GSM, GPRS) => dbits multiplis par 3 EDGE+GSM : un circuit de donnes => 43,2 kbits/s / canal physique EDGE+GPRS : 59,2 kbits/s / canal physique (en mode paquet) capacits frquentielles mmes quipements que pour le GSM
24

Dbits

Limites (~ GPRS)

=> Vers une nouvelle norme : la 3G !


Frdric Payan - Dpartement R&T - IUT de Nice Cte d'Azur